Brief Explanations:

A compound - complex sentence has at least two independent clauses and one dependent clause. The original sentences "Learning a language can be difficult. It is one of the most useful hobbies. I've tried it." need to be combined. Option D combines them correctly. "Learning a language can be difficult" is an independent clause, "it is one of the most useful hobbies" is an independent clause, and "that I've tried" is a dependent clause modifying "hobbies". The conjunction "yet" connects the two independent clauses.

Answer:

D. Learning a language can be difficult, yet it is one of the most useful hobbies that I've tried.
